Working Principles

The MCW34074A operates based on a switching regulator principle. It utilizes an internal oscillator to control the switching frequency, which converts the input voltage to a regulated output voltage. The feedback mechanism continuously monitors the output voltage and adjusts the duty cycle of the internal switch to maintain a stable output.
